Know what is special about this picture, this  launch of the shuttle Columbia? 

Hint:  The color of the fuel tank.

Answer:   The first two shuttle launches had the tank painted white, but to save 400 pounds of weight, they stopped painting it, and since then the tank shows it's original orange/brown color.
